反调试原理:关于Ptrace: http://www.cnblogs.com/tangr206/articles/3094358.htmlptrace函数 原型为: #include long ptrace(enum __ptrace_request request, pid_t pid, void... ...
分类:
移动开发 时间:
2017-05-02 10:16:07
阅读次数:
453
逆向手机内核,绕过TracePid反调试参考文章:1. http://bbs.pediy.com/thread-207538.htm2. http://www.wjdiankong.cn/android 需求:常见的Android 反调试方案其实并不多, 就那么几种, 其中一种方案通过轮训Trace... ...
分类:
移动开发 时间:
2017-05-01 01:19:36
阅读次数:
432
在前一篇文章中详细介绍了Android现阶段可以采用的几种反调试方案策略,我们在破解逆向应用的时候,一般现在第一步都回去解决反调试,不然后续步骤无法进行,当然如果你是静态分析的话获取就没必要了。但是有...
分类:
移动开发 时间:
2017-04-17 21:14:28
阅读次数:
443
0x1.手机设备环境 Model number: Nexus 5 OS Version: Android 4.4.4 KTU84P Kernel Version: 3.4.0-gd59db4e ...
分类:
移动开发 时间:
2017-02-26 23:37:25
阅读次数:
298
0x1.手机设备环境
Model number: Nexus 5
OS Version: Android 4.4.4 KTU84P
Kernel Version: 3.4.0-gd59db4e
...
分类:
移动开发 时间:
2017-02-26 21:10:42
阅读次数:
632
在调试一些病毒程序的时候,可能会碰到一些反调试技术,也就是说,被调试的程序可以检测到自己是否被调试器附加了,如果探知自己正在被调试,肯定是有人试图反汇编啦之类的方法破解自己。为了了解如何破解反调试技术,首先我们来看看反调试技术。 一、Windows API方法 Win32提供了两个API, IsDe ...
重所周知,有破解就必有防破解,二者本为一体 破解技术就不要我多介绍了,下面我来介绍反调试技术 也就是所谓的防破解技术 反调试技术可以简单通俗的理解为:防止OD分析软件的技术,也就是反调试技术 那么反调试技术又有几种呢? 下面我介绍几种常用反调试技术 首先声明,下面有一部分内容来源百度,若有喷子觉得恶 ...
分类:
其他好文 时间:
2016-11-30 03:22:00
阅读次数:
530
参考师弟的贴子修改的, 基本我一次就弄好了, 没有遇到啥问题, 下面我主要是补充下他的帖子http://bbs.pediy.com/showthread.php?t=213481 一. 环境搭建(1). 环境介绍:手机:nexus 5ubuntu版本:15.10android版本:4.4.4andr... ...
分类:
其他好文 时间:
2016-11-28 22:52:31
阅读次数:
248
Android 系统安全愈发重要,像传统pc安全的可执行文件加固一样,应用加固是Android系统安全中非常重要的一环。目前Android 应用加固可以分为dex加固和Native加固,Native 加固的保护对象为 Native 层的 SO 文件,使用加壳、反调试、混淆、VM 等手段增加SO文件的... ...
分类:
移动开发 时间:
2016-11-09 20:01:04
阅读次数:
278
1.前言Android系统安全愈发重要,像传统pc安全的可执行文件加固一样,应用加固是Android系统安全中非常重要的一环。目前Android应用加固可以分为dex加固和Native加固,Native加固的保护对象为Native层的SO文件,使用加壳、反调试、混淆、VM等手段增加SO文件的反编译难度。目前..
分类:
移动开发 时间:
2016-10-17 23:52:15
阅读次数:
354